New Memorial Markers Featured in Award-Winning Development

2019–10–11

The memorial grove at Alstadhaug Cemetery in Norway received the first prize for best memorial grove in 2019. The award was presented by the Norwegian Association for Cemetery Culture. Nola’s contributions to the project included the Memory memorial marker designed by Løventanna Landskap, and Kalmar backed benches designed by Lars Gunnars.

Named ‘Memory’, the memorial marker is comprised of 96 individual name plaques that give the setting a more personal atmosphere. The bottom part provides a low plinth for flowers and candles. The series also includes holders for watering cans and garden tools, designed in the same style as the memorial market itself. The style of the marker and accompanying garden accessories are shared throughout the site, but the individual memorial markers are adapted for each individual area. Each of the Kalmar backed benches were given the same surface treatment and colour palette as the memorial markers, creating a congruent colour theme throughout the site.

Løventanna Landskap, the designers behind Memory, based the design on the old tradition of engraving names onto metal plaques. They updated traditional plaques with laser-cut patterns that enable light to pass through. Although the design is decorative, Memory is made in a subtle style that shows respect for solemn surroundings.
